Electrical Installation Works Method Statement: Ensuring Safe and Compliant Electrical Installations
The Electrical Installation Works Method Statement is a crucial document for projects involving electrical wiring, circuit installations, and power system connections. It provides a structured safe system of work, ensuring compliance with UK health and safety regulations, including the Electricity at Work Regulations 1989, the BS 7671: Requirements for Electrical Installations (IET Wiring Regulations), and the Construction (Design and Management) Regulations 2015 (CDM 2015).
